Visual exploration can be used in various industries to analyze and interpret complex data sets. For instance, in the healthcare industry, it can be used to visualize patient data and identify patterns or anomalies. In the finance industry, it can be used to analyze financial data and predict market trends. In the manufacturing industry, it can be used to monitor production processes and identify areas for improvement. The possibilities are endless and depend on the specific needs and data available in each industry.

As an example, Berinato uses Tesla Motors' Data Scientist, Anmol Garg. Garg has used visual exploration to tap into the vast amount of sensor data Tesla cars produce. He developed an interactive chart that shows the pressure in a car's tires over time. "In true exploratory form, first created the visualizations and then found a variety of uses for them: to see whether tires are properly inflated when a car leaves the factory, how often customers reinflate them, and how long customers take to respond to a low-pressure alert; to find leak rates; and to do some predictive modeling on when tires are likely to go flat. The pressure of all four tires is visualized on a scatter plot, which, however inscrutable to a general audience, is clear to its intended audience," Berinato writes.
